Output 720505936ef78dbfbd386eb57cc6075613f7a298febc1d011eef2d097397612a:0

value
464786
script pubkey
OP_0 OP_PUSHBYTES_20 90580c34520357f741acdc80131111d896ee34a4
address
bc1qjpvqcdzjqdtlwsdvmjqpxyg3mztwud9y0yalhw
transaction
720505936ef78dbfbd386eb57cc6075613f7a298febc1d011eef2d097397612a
spent
true